Create an event on day 1 from 9pm to 2am (the next day).  Create an 
event on day 2 at 4:30pm.



The continuation of the first event which spans two days will show up 
in the 9pm time slot on day 2 after the 4:30pm event.  It would be 
nice if the continued event showed up first thing on day 2 as you 
would expect.
